Forward (does not run in reverse)
ConnectavoltmeteracrossthePMCKSIterminalandbattery
negative.
Close all interlock switches, turn the Key Switch
ON, and place the F&R Switch in reverse.
• If the voltage is not at battery volts then go to
the Key Switch sequence.
Connect a voltmeteracross the Reverse Solenoid coil
terminals.Refertoyourvehicleswiringdiagramtoidentify
thepositionofthereversesolenoid.
Close all interlock switches, turn the Key Switch ON,
and place the F&R Switch in reverse.
Depress the accelerator pedal fully.
• If the voltage is not at battery volts then go to the F/R
Switch sequence.
Setthetestlightvoltagetothesamevoltageasthebattery
volts.
Connectthetestlightacrossthenormallyopencontactsof
thereversesolenoid.Refertoyourvehicleswiringdiagram
toidentifythepositionofthereversesolenoid.
Close all interlock switches, turn the Key Switch ON,
and place the F&R Switch in reverse.
Depress the accelerator pedal fully.
• If the light comes on then the Reverse solenoid has
failed. Stop trouble shooting here and repair the
problem.Whentherepairiscompleted,completely
retest the vehicle before lowering the drive wheels to
the ground.
